JME - Application Documentation
    Preparing search index...

    Type Alias RoundaboutStructure

    Pre-computed geometric structure for an entire roundabout

    type RoundaboutStructure = {
        avgRadius: number;
        edgeTubes: THREE.TubeGeometry[];
        exitStructures: RoundaboutExitStructure[];
        floorCircle: THREE.RingGeometry;
        id: string;
        islandGeometry: THREE.CircleGeometry;
        islandRadius: number;
        laneMidRadii: number[];
        maxDistanceToStopLine: number;
        outerRadius: number;
        ringLines: RingLaneStructure[];
        roundaboutFloor: THREE.ShapeGeometry;
    }
    Index

    Properties

    avgRadius: number
    edgeTubes: THREE.TubeGeometry[]
    exitStructures: RoundaboutExitStructure[]
    floorCircle: THREE.RingGeometry
    id: string
    islandGeometry: THREE.CircleGeometry
    islandRadius: number
    laneMidRadii: number[]
    maxDistanceToStopLine: number
    outerRadius: number
    ringLines: RingLaneStructure[]
    roundaboutFloor: THREE.ShapeGeometry